March 24th-30th, 2025 | Upper Madison River Fishing Report

Ahhhhhhh Finally! It’s Spring in the Epic Madison Valley! We made it through another Winter. Our Snowpack looks great (still being added to!) thankfully our watershed will be safe for another season. Almost all Fishing Accesses on the Upper Madison are open and clear for use, with the exception of Ennis Town Access (the Gorge really did a number on it this year).

For our Awesome Fishing Report, Dan Delekta reports:

So much fun with my first Two Float Trips on the Madison River with the Father and Son duo, Sean & Brian Murphy! Day 1 was Lyons Bridge to Ruby Creek followed by Day 2 floating Ruby Creek to Varney Bridge. Browns, Rainbows, & Whitefish were actively biting #8-#10 Delektable Hurless Nymph Gray Flashback, Delektable Mega Prince STD Flashback #8-#10, Delektable FB Sparkle Kaboom Stone & Sparkle Kaboom Stone, Delektable Lil’ Spanker Pheasant Tail #14-#16 and Delektable TGBH Formerly Prince #16! Double Stones, Baby!!!  Dead drifted small Streamer patterns were also very productive.

Nymphs: Delektable Sparkle Kaboom Stone #6-#8; Delektable Flashback Sparkle Kaboom Stone #6-#8; Delektable Gold BH Formerly Mega Prince STD #6-#8; Delketable Hurless Nymph Gray Flashback #6-#8;“ Delektable JH Tungsten Spanker Holo Black #16-#18; Delektable JH Tungsten Micro Spanker Holo Black & Pheasant Tail #16-#18; Geppert’s Crystal Dip Black #16-#18;

Streamers: Mini Loop Sculpin Olive #6; Mini Dali Llama Olive/White #10; Sculpzilla Olive/White #8; Delektable Screamer Single Olive/White #6.

Dries: Trico Spinner Double Wing #18; Adams Midge Cluster #18-#20; Female Spinner Trico #18-#20; Grizzly Midge Cluster #20.
